Josh Cochran is an illustrator and muralist originating from California and Taiwan, currently living in Brooklyn. He has received a Grammy nomination for album art, a Young Guns award, and medals from the Society of Illustrators. Notable clients include Adidas, Apple, Criterion Collection, Dubai Metro, Eames Foundation, Google, New Yorker, Nike, NPR, U.S. Open, and Warby Parker. He has recently delved into children’s books, most notably illustrating “DRAWING ON WALL: A Story Of Keith Haring.” He also teaches at the School of Visual Arts NYC. His installations and murals are featured in The New York Transit Museum, Lea Elementary School West Philly, and the Asian Arts Initiative.
